IN THE NEWS: Feature on UC Davis drought website

The Arboretum and Public Garden was featured in May on the home page “Spotlight” of the UC Davis California Drought Watch website (shown above as it appeared in spring).

The UC Davis campus has saved more than 22-million gallons of water so far in 2014 compared to the same time period last year. Most of the savings have come from the use of more drought-tolerant landscaping and adjustments in watering schedules. READ MORE
